What Are AC Disconnect Switches
AC disconnect switches are dedicated electrical devices that safely cut power to air conditioning units. They protect people and equipment during service, troubleshooting, or emergencies. Where Are AC Disconnect Switches Used
AC disconnect switches are required in most residential and light commercial AC installations.
Residential
Installed near outdoor central air conditioners, heat pumps, or window units. They allow safe power shutoff before maintenance or in case of malfunction, as required by electrical codes.
Light Commercial
Used in small offices, retail spaces, and light industrial facilities with larger AC systems. Higher‑capacity models ensure safety for staff, customers, and service technicians.
Why AC Disconnect Switches Are Essential
1. Electrical codes require AC disconnect switches for residential and light commercial cooling systems.
2. Prevent electric shock: Fully de-energize equipment before any work on high‑voltage AC units
3. Protect equipment: Quickly shut off power during surges or short circuits to avoid costly damage
4. Speed up emergency response: Immediate power cut if a unit malfunctions, overheats, or risks fire
How to Choose and Maintain AC Disconnect Switches
Choose the Right Rating
Match voltage and current to your AC unit. 240V 30A is common for residential use; light commercial systems may need 60A or higher. Always check your unit’s specifications.
Install Properly
Mount within 50 feet of the AC unit, at an accessible height. Ensure correct grounding. Use a licensed electrician for safe, code‑compliant installation.
Perform Regular Maintenance
Inspect annually for corrosion, damage, or loose connections. Clean the enclosure and test on/off function. Replace the switch at the first sign of wear or failure.
